ASTROCYTES
Main role:
- Enshesth synapses, regulate neural excitability and synaptic transmission.
- Respond to injury by secreting extra cellular matrix proteins.
- Implicated in Neuro Genesis, cell migration and many neurological and Psychiatric disorders.
- Regulate the transmission of electrical signals across synapses by modifying the concentration of extra cellular potassium; Controlling local blood flow, releasing and taking up neuro transmitters and other Neuro modulatory substances, delivering nutrients to neurons, and altering the Geometry and volume of space between brain cells. All these things influence nervous system, communication and plasticity.
- Astrocytes have anatomical and physiological properties that may impose higher- order organization on information processing in the brain. In the gray matter of the cerebral cortex and Hypocampus, Astrocytes are organized in non overlaping domains.
- The largest cell body, had been found to stop up extra neurotransmitter molecules around neurons, there by protecting nerve cells from receiving too much stimulation.
- A fatty complex called APOE/Cholestrol and the protein Thrombospondin, these two chemicals are released by astrocytes to stimulate synapsys formation.
- Astrocytes might contribute to a greater capacity for learning.
- Neurons are like telephone communicating electrically through hard wired synaptic connections, Astrocytes may be like cell phones communicating with chemical signals that broadcast widely but can be detected only by other astrocytes.
- Astrocytes have listening ability.

Stanford university, which used
functional magnetic resonance imaging(FMRI) to track patter patterns of
activation in the brain, founds the older adults are more responsive to positive
images than to negative one’s. Compared to younger adults, people aged seventy
to ninety showed greater activation in a brain region that is central to
emotional processing(The Amygdla) when they looked at the pictures of people
expressing positive emotions verses negative one. Older adults experience fewer
negative emotions and are less likely to remember negative emotional stimuli
than positive stimuli.

The cortex is only 3 to 5
millimeters thick, but takes up more than a third of brain’s volume, because it
is folded like the shell of a walnut into a maze of hills and valleys. Anterior cingulate cortex involves in
regulating the autonomic nervous system, including heart rate, breathe rate and
B.P. Parietal lobe play a role in both
sense and spatial perception.
Somatosensory cortex analyses information relating to pain, pressure,
touch, and temperature from all parts of the body. The inner Hippocampus, Amygdala are the heart
of the memoy and emotions. The temporal
lobe is also involved in hearing (Nadha), as it contains the auditory cortex,
the chief brain are for sound and speech processing. Occipital lobe which contain the primary
visual cortex.
